摘要:
AbstractExpoxy bisphenol‐A resins (A), epoxy novolac resins (B) and epoxy furfuryl alcohol resins (C) were prepared using different molar ratios of epichlorohydrin and the respective hydroxy compounds. These resins were cured with different hardeners, namely diethylenetriamine (DTA), dithioterephthalic acid (DTTPA), mercapto succinic acid (MSA), and phthalic anhydride (PA). The thermal behaviour of the cured epoxy resins was studied. From the energy of activation data and IPDT values it was concluded that DTTPA gave the highest thermal stability of all these curing agents.
